@@jylee9980 tell that to the colts, chargers, raiders, rams, cardinals, braves, thunder/sonic, clippers, kings, hawks, nets, pistons, warriors, dodgers, nationals, titans, and grizzlies. Pretty much the only teams to ever change their city and not take their history are the pelicans when they moved from charlotte and the ravens when they moved from Cleveland. They are the exception, not the rule.

Some of the teams (e.g. "Sacramento Kings") went through 4+ cities (Rochester Royals/Cincinnati Royals/ Kansas City/Omaha Kings/ Sacramento Kings).
